Introduction / Overview: Your Rustic Retreat at Fancy Creek Campground

For Kansas locals seeking a rugged, natural camping experience coupled with high-octane outdoor adventure, the Fancy Creek State Park unit of Tuttle Creek State Park is a hidden gem. Located on the western side of the massive Tuttle Creek Reservoir, Fancy Creek stands apart from the park's other units, offering a more rustic and secluded environment that appeals strongly to tent campers, primitive campers, and enthusiasts who prioritize the wild side of the Flint Hills. While it provides essential amenities, the atmosphere here is dominated by lakeside views, thickly wooded areas, and some of the most challenging terrain available for mountain biking and hiking in the entire state.

Fancy Creek is specifically celebrated for its signature 6-mile mountain bike trail—an intermediate to advanced loop known for its steep climbs, rock outcrops, and dense cedar forest sections. This unit is not just a destination for a quiet weekend; it's a base camp for adrenaline, fishing, and target sports. The campground, particularly the Hidden Hollow Loop where the Camp Host is situated, offers a variety of non-water-hookup electric sites and vast areas for traditional primitive tent camping, ensuring a truly back-to-nature experience in the heart of Kansas.

If your perfect weekend involves lakeside serenity, a challenging outdoor workout, and the smell of a campfire in a less-crowded setting, Fancy Creek is deliberately designed for your kind of adventure.

Location and Accessibility

Fancy Creek State Park is uniquely positioned on the west side of Tuttle Creek Lake, offering picturesque views and a feeling of seclusion while remaining easily accessible from major highways. It is situated a short drive from the small town of Randolph, Kansas.

The core campground area, including the central location for the Camp Host, is generally accessed via:

Hidden Hollow Rd, Randolph, KS 66554, USA

For those traveling from the Manhattan area or further south, the park is typically reached by taking Highway 77 north, then turning east onto Highway 16 near Randolph. The Fancy Creek entrance is clearly marked off Highway 16, just before the bridge that spans the reservoir. Its location on the western shoreline makes it a convenient gateway for those looking to access the Randolph Trail System or the rugged trails of the western Flint Hills. Visitors should note that while electricity is provided at designated utility sites, water hookups are generally not available directly at individual campsites, though community water hydrants or water sources may be available nearby in the area.

Services Offered

Fancy Creek focuses on providing essential, clean, and functional services tailored to a more rugged camping style. The presence of a dedicated Camp Host, often located near the Hidden Hollow Loop, ensures a point of contact for local assistance and information.

  • Electric Campsites: The campground offers 24 reservable electric-only campsites (20/30 amp) suitable for RVs or trailers. These sites provide a level of modern convenience without detracting from the rustic setting.
  • Primitive Camping: Approximately 200 non-designated primitive campsites are available, catering to traditional tent camping and those seeking a true wilderness experience near the shoreline.
  • Restroom Facilities: The area is equipped with vault toilets, and there are two new ADA-accessible restrooms available for public use.
  • Day-Use Shelters: Several shaded shelters are available for picnicking and day-use gatherings, offering beautiful lakeside views.
  • Boat Ramp and Dock: A boat ramp and courtesy dock are located within the Fancy Creek unit, providing direct access to the main body of Tuttle Creek Reservoir for fishing and water sports.
  • Self-Pay Station: A self-pay station is located at the campground entrance for purchasing daily vehicle passes, which is required for all visitors entering the area.
  • Camp Host Presence: A Camp Host is on-site near the Hidden Hollow Loop vault bathroom to provide immediate support, answer questions, and assist in connecting with park rangers or maintenance personnel if necessary.

Features / Highlights

The Fancy Creek unit’s unique landscape and facilities make it a standout destination for specific types of outdoor recreation in the Kansas park system.

  • Advanced Mountain Bike Trail: The primary highlight is the 6-mile Fancy Creek Mountain Bike Trail, known for its steep climbs, rocky sections, and technical terrain. It is widely considered one of the most challenging and rewarding trails in Kansas, winding through dense cedar forest and native grassland.
  • Fancy Creek Shooting Range: The unit is home to a state-of-the-art shooting range, which is typically open on the first and third full weekends of each month, offering a dedicated, safe environment for firearms practice (users should always confirm operating status).
  • Rugged, Rustic Scenery: Fancy Creek offers a more secluded and heavily wooded environment than the main River Pond area, making it a perfect escape for those who prefer a less developed, more natural camping backdrop.
  • Excellent Shoreline Fishing: The proximity to the reservoir and the Big Blue River provides ample opportunity for shoreline fishing, with popular catches including crappie, channel cat, and flathead catfish.
  • Unique Primitive Camping: With a large capacity for 200 primitive units, Fancy Creek is ideal for large groups, scouts, or individuals seeking a traditional tent camping experience near the water’s edge.
  • Day-Use Opportunities: The day-use areas are popular for their shaded, scenic shelters that are perfect for a picnic before a hike or bike ride.
